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/ PowerBuilder [игнор отключен] [закрыт для гостей] / необходимо из PowerBuilder открыть html-страницу в OpenOffice Calc / 3 сообщений из 3, страница 1 из 1
23.06.2008, 17:20
    #35389140
kalginap
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
необходимо из PowerBuilder открыть html-страницу в OpenOffice Calc
Здравствуйте. Я столкнулся с такой задачей: необходимо из PowerBuilder открыть html-страницу в OpenOffice Calc. В интернете мне удалось найти некоторую информацию о том как это можно сделать и я написал следующий код

OLEObject lole_OpenOfficeCalc, lole_desctop, lole_PropertyValue
int li_status

lole_OpenOfficeCalc = CREATE OLEObject
lole_desctop = CREATE OLEObject

li_status = lole_OpenOfficeCalc.ConnectToNewObject("com.sun.star.ServiceManager")

if li_status<>0 then
destroy lole_OpenOfficeCalc
MessageBox(ls_ErrTitle, 'Коннект в OpenOffice-у ~r')
return -1
end if

lole_desctop = lole_OpenOfficeCalc.CreateInstance("com.sun.star.frame.Desktop")
lole_PropertyValue = lole_desctop.Bridge_GetStruct("com.sun.star.beans.PropertyValue");
lole_PropertyValue.Name = "FilterName"
lole_PropertyValue.Value = "HTML (StarCalc)"

lole_desctop.LoadComponentFromURL('file:///E:/Doc/index.php.htm', "_blank", 0, lole_PropertyValue)


При выполнении метода LoadComponentFromURL возникает ошибка "Error calling external object function loadcomponentfromurl at line 29". Причиной этой ошибки является то, что последний параметр этого метода должен быть задан ккак-то иначе.

Но как?
Как правильно передать в метод LoadComponentFromURL опции открытия документа?
...
Рейтинг: 0 / 0
23.06.2008, 18:03
    #35389271
Локшин Марк
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
необходимо из PowerBuilder открыть html-страницу в OpenOffice Calc
kalginapЗдравствуйте. Я столкнулся с такой задачей: необходимо из PowerBuilder открыть html-страницу в OpenOffice Calc. В интернете мне удалось найти некоторую информацию о том как это можно сделать и я написал следующий код

И что в том примере было?
...
Рейтинг: 0 / 0
23.06.2008, 21:37
    #35389558
spas2001
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
необходимо из PowerBuilder открыть html-страницу в OpenOffice Calc
Ага
Скорее всего
lole_desctop. object .LoadComponentFromURL('file:///E:/Doc/index.php.htm', "_blank", 0, lole_PropertyValue)
-----------------------------------------------------------------------------
Главная деталь любой машины - голова ее владельца
...
Рейтинг: 0 / 0
Форумы / PowerBuilder [игнор отключен] [закрыт для гостей] / необходимо из PowerBuilder открыть html-страницу в OpenOffice Calc / 3 сообщений из 3,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]